This study investigates the political economy of industrialization in Ethiopia. It discusses the economic and political institutions during three political regimes and assesses the industrial sector's performance across these different regimes. Further, it evaluates the different industrial strategies and organizational structures for implementing the industrial policies together with the current industrial park strategy and its contemporary impact on employment creation, export promotion, foreign exchange revenues, the value chain, and spillover effects. Both qualitative and quantitative approaches are used for exploring the role of political economy in Ethiopian industrialization. Different political strategies were followed by the political regimes to support the industrial sector. The paper distinguishes between two extreme political strategies of protectionist import substitution industrialization and the outward strategy of export-oriented industrialization. The study confirms that political institutions negatively impacted industry for several decades. The results support focusing on institutions to successfully implement industry policies for inducing the industrialization process in the country. Policies must be implemented considering existing opportunities and resources in the country along with their respective economic outcomes instead of excessive priority being given to the political interests of the regime in power.

This research investigates the Ethiopian economy's sectoral linkages. It examines the forward and backward production and total linkages of the industry with the agriculture and service sectors. The import penetration and export intensity of the agriculture-based industry and the manufacturing industry are also discussed. The study used the Ethiopian Social Accounting Matrix (SAM) database and made a multiplier analysis to explore the linkages and estimate the multiplier coefficients. The results show that agriculture has a relatively strong linkage with other sectors while the agriculture-based industry has weak forward linkages, and the manufacturing industry has weak backward and forward linkages with other sectors of the economy. The multiplier analysis shows that an exogenous shock to the agriculture-based industry has a higher multiplier effect than a shock to the manufacturing industry. Economic policy should focus on agriculture-based industry investments to positively augment the Ethiopian industrialization process and the overall economy.

Inclusive financial systems, whereby everyone enjoys the benefits of financial services, has become one of the top global priorities. Notwithstanding the emphasis on the role of financial inclusion (FI), a large proportion of adults across the world in general, and in low-income countries in particular, are without access to formal financial services. Africa performs worse in terms of FI compared to other developing regions. In addition to ensuring inclusive financial systems, a global consensus has been recently reached regarding the role of inclusive economies in achieving stable and sustainable growth. To ensure inclusive economies, the reduction of inequality within and across countries has become one of the top priorities of the United Nations’ Sustainable Development Goals. Africa is the second most unequal continent; while it has demonstrated strong economic growth over the past two decades, that growth has not been “pro-poor”. Against such a background, this thesis aims to achieve five major objectives in the context of Africa. Firstly, the thesis multidimensionally develops a measurement of FI using two-stage indexing approach. The results show that extensive margin and geographic coverage of financial services contribute to much of the variation in FI. Secondly, employing an endogenous panel threshold estimation approach, the thesis examines the effect of foreign banks presence on FI and demonstrates that foreign bank presence reduces financial inclusion; however, the negative effect is observed only after a threshold of foreign bank presence is reached. Moreover, it shows that the effect of foreign bank presence depends on institutional quality of the host countries. The results further demonstrate that foreign bank presence enhances the intensive margin but reduces the extensive margin of financial services. Thirdly, employing panel semiparametric regression, this thesis analyses the effect of FI on financial stability and demonstrates that FI below (above) threshold enhances (reduces) financial stability. Moreover, the thesis employs panel quantile regression and finds that the effect of FI depends on initial levels of financial stability. The thesis further shows that the effect of FI on financial stability is reinforced in a competitive financial market structure. Fourthly, using endogenous panel threshold estimation, the thesis examines the effect of FI on income inequality and shows that only FI above a threshold reduces income inequality. Employing panel quantile regression, this thesis finds that the effect of FI depends on initial levels of income inequality. It further demonstrates that the favourable distributional impact of FI is reinforced at higher levels of institutional quality. Finally, by employing a heterogenous panel estimation approach, the thesis analyses the relationship between FI and effectiveness of inflation targeting monetary policy. The results demonstrate that common shocks do not have significant effect in the case of full sample countries and nonmonetary union countries. In the case of monetary union countries, West African Economic and Monetary Union (WAEMU), the thesis finds that idiosyncratic, common and composite shocks have significant impacts, with varying magnitudes, signs, times of response and persistence. Emphasizing on WAEMU, this thesis demonstrates effectiveness of monetary policy is differently associated with the dimensions and indicators of FI. Overall, FI shocks temporarily increase inflation; deposit shocks reduce inflation; and credit shocks increase inflation. Central bank policy rate increases to credit shocks indicating that the monetary authority responds to credit shocks by implementing contractionary monetary policy. The findings of the thesis imply that, in Africa, promoting financial inclusion is crucial to achieve stable financial system, inclusive economy, and effective monetary policy. The results indicate that while promotion of FI in general is important, an emphasis on the extensive margin and geographic outreach of financial services is crucial. The results also highlight that competitive financial structure is vital for reinforcing the positive effect of FI on financial stability. The results further imply that improving institutional quality is critical to reinforce income inequality reducing effect of FI, and to utilize foreign bank presence as an opportunity to enhance an inclusive financial system amidst ever-increasing financial globalization.

Opuntia ficus-indica(L.) Miller is a CAM (crassulacean acid metabolism) plant with an extraordinary capacity to adapt to drought stress by its ability to fix atmospheric CO2at nighttime, store a significant amount of water in cladodes, and reduce root growth. Plants that grow in moisture-stress conditions with thick and less fine root hairs have a strong symbiosis with arbuscular mycorrhizal fungi (AMF) to adapt to drought stress. Water stress can limit plant growth and biomass production, which can be rehabilitated by AMF association through improved physiological performance. The objective of this study was to investigate the effects of AMF inoculations and variable soil water levels on the biomass, photosynthesis, and water use efficiency of the spiny and spineless O. ficus-indica. The experiment was conducted in a greenhouse with a full factorial experiment using O. ficus-indicatype (spiny or spineless), AMF (presence or absence), and four soil water available (SWA) treatments through seven replications. Water treatments applied were 0%–25% SWA (T1), 25%–50% SWA (T2), 50%–75% SWA (T3), and 75%–100% SWA (T4). Drought stress reduced biomass and cladode growth, while AMF colonization significantly increased the biomass production with significant changes in the physiological performance of O. ficus-indica. AMF presence significantly increased biomass of both O. ficus-indicaplant types through improved growth, photosynthetic water use efficiency, and photosynthesis. The presence of spines on the surface of cladodes significantly reduced the rate of photosynthesis and photosynthetic water use efficiency. Net photosynthesis, photosynthetic water use efficiency, transpiration, and stomatal conductance rate significantly decreased with increased drought stress. Under drought stress, some planted mother cladodes with the absence of AMF have not established daughter cladodes, whereas AMF-inoculated mother cladodes fully established daughter cladodes. AMF root colonization significantly increased with the decrease of SWA. AMF caused an increase in biomass production, increased tolerance to drought stress, and improved photosynthesis and water use efficiency performance of O. ficus-indica. The potential of O. ficus-indicato adapt to drought stress is controlled by the morpho-physiological performance related to AMF association.

Background: Understanding the magnitude of cancer burden attributable to potentially modifiable risk factors is crucial for development of effective prevention and mitigation strategies. We analysed results from the Global Burden of Diseases, Injuries, and Risk Factors Study (GBD) 2019 to inform cancer control planning efforts globally. Methods: The GBD 2019 comparative risk assessment framework was used to estimate cancer burden attributable to behavioural, environmental and occupational, and metabolic risk factors. A total of 82 risk-outcome pairs were included on the basis of the World Cancer Research Fund criteria. Estimated cancer deaths and disability-adjusted life-years (DALYs) in 2019 and change in these measures between 2010 and 2019 are presented. Findings: Globally, in 2019, the risk factors included in this analysis accounted for 4·45 million (95% uncertainty interval 4·01-4·94) deaths and 105 million (95·0-116) DALYs for both sexes combined, representing 44·4% (41·3-48·4) of all cancer deaths and 42·0% (39·1-45·6) of all DALYs. There were 2·88 million (2·60-3·18) risk-attributable cancer deaths in males (50·6% [47·8-54·1] of all male cancer deaths) and 1·58 million (1·36-1·84) risk-attributable cancer deaths in females (36·3% [32·5-41·3] of all female cancer deaths). The leading risk factors at the most detailed level globally for risk-attributable cancer deaths and DALYs in 2019 for both sexes combined were smoking, followed by alcohol use and high BMI. Risk-attributable cancer burden varied by world region and Socio-demographic Index (SDI), with smoking, unsafe sex, and alcohol use being the three leading risk factors for risk-attributable cancer DALYs in low SDI locations in 2019, whereas DALYs in high SDI locations mirrored the top three global risk factor rankings. Ethiopia’s 60 million chickens are reared primarily in free range, smallholder systems. Therefore, upgrading smallholder poultry to small-scale commercial systems is central to rural development. With the aim of providing access to improved chicken by rural farmers in Ethiopia, the live body weight at week 17 and number of eggs per bird per week for one locally improved and three tropically adapted dual-purpose chicken strains was tested through a project called the African Chicken Genetic Gains. Both traits were analyzed by fitting a linear mixed model with week and pen as random effects, and station and breed as fixed effects. The result showed that both breed and station effects were significant for both traits. The introduced breeds performed better than the local improved breed for both traits. Thus, the introduction of system-appropriate high-yielding tropically adapted breeds has the potential to increase the productivity of chicken.

Access to and processing of personal data is regulated by norms that are written down in legal source documents, including laws, regulations and contracts. Compliance can be automated through the formalisation of these norms, reducing human effort and making the applied interpretations explicit. In addition, trust between parties may increase, thus promoting collaborations to gain more insights from sharing data. Although several policy specification languages have been proposed, there are not many that can be used to specify both social policies, such as privacy regulations and contracts, and system-level policies such as those used for access control. In this work, we present extensions to eFLINT, a domain-specific language developed to formalise norms from various sources. The extensions make it possible to interconnect social and system-level policies. We demonstrate the new features of eFLINT within the healthcare domain by formalising the regulatory document of the SIOPE DIPG/DMG Network, a consortium established to advance research into a rare form of pediatric brain cancer, and by showing how the resulting specifications are used to automate compliance checking of access and processing requests made by members of the consortium.

This study investigates the effect of energy use on labor productivity in the Ethiopian manufacturing industry. It uses panel data for the manufacturing industry groups to estimate the coefficients using the dynamic panel estimator. The study's results confirm that energy use increases manufacturing labor productivity. The coefficients for the control variables are in keeping with theoretical predictions. Capital positively augments productivity in the industries. Based on our results, technology induces manufacturing's labor productivity. Likewise, more labor employment induces labor productivity due to the dominance of labor-intensive manufacturing industries in Ethiopia. Alternative model specifications provide evidence of a robust link between energy and labor productivity in the Ethiopian manufacturing industry. Our results imply that there needs to be more focus on the efficient use of energy, labor, capital, and technology to increase the manufacturing industry's labor productivity and to overcome the premature deindustrialization patterns being seen in Ethiopia. © 2020 by the authors.

In this work, a range of van der Waals type density functionals are applied to the H2O/NaCl(001) and H2O/MgO(001) interface systems to explore the effect of an explicit dispersion treatment. The functionals we use are the self-consistent vdW functionalsvdW-DF,vdW-DF2, optPBE-vdW, optB88- vdW, optB86b-vdW, and vdW-DF-cx, as well as the dispersion-corrected PBE-TS and PBE-D2 methods; they are all compared with the standard PBE functional. For both NaCl(001) and MgO(001), we find that the dispersion-flavoured functionals stabilize thewater-surface interface by approximately 20%-40% compared to the PBE results. For NaCl(001), where the water molecules remain intact for all overlayers, the dominant contribution to the adsorption energy from "density functional theory dispersion" stems from the water-surface interactions rather than the water-water interactions. The optPBE-vdW and vdW-DF-cx functionals yield adsorption energies in good agreement with available experimental values for both NaCl and MgO. To probe the strengths of the perturbations of the adsorbed water molecules, we also calculated water dipole moments and found an increase up to 85% for water at the MgO(001) surface and 70% at the NaCl(001) surface, compared to the gas-phase dipole moment. This paper concerns thin water films and their hydrogen-bond patterns on ionic surfaces. As far as we are aware, this is the first time H-bond correlations for surface water and hydroxide species are presented in the literature while hydrogen-bond relations in the solid state have been scrutinized for at least five decades. Our data set, which was derived using density functional theory, consists of 116 unique surface OH groups–intact water molecules as well as hydroxides–on MgO(001), CaO(001) and NaCl(001), covering the whole range fromstrong toweak tono H-bonds. The intact surface water molecules are found to always be redshifted with respect to the gas-phase water OH vibrational frequency, whereas the surface hydroxide groups are either redshifted (OsH) or blueshifted (OHf) compared to the gas-phase OH–frequency. The surface H-bond relations are compared with the traditional relations for bulk crystals. We find that the “ν(OH) vs R(H···O)” correlation curve for surface water does not coincide with the solid state curve: it is redshifted by about 200 cm–1or more. The intact water molecules and hydroxide groups on the ionic surfaces essentially follow the same H-bond correlation curve.

Current evidence indicates the effects of periodontitis on diabetes as well as mortality, for which diabetes itself represents a risk factor. However, the possible interaction of these 2 chronic conditions regarding mortality has not yet been investigated. Therefore, the purpose of this study was to evaluate whether periodontal destruction interacts with diabetes on all-cause and cardiovascular disease (CVD) mortality or if diabetes serves as a mediator in this association. The study sample comprised 3,327 participants aged 20 to 81 y from the Study of Health in Pomerania. Periodontal destruction was assessed via clinical attachment level (CAL) and the number of missing teeth. Information on mortality (date and ICD-10 code) was ascertained from death certificates. Directed acyclic graphs were used to identify potential confounders, and Cox proportional hazard models were applied. In 36,701 person-years of follow-up, 263 study participants deceased, 89 due to CVD. Fully adjusted main effect models resulted in hazard ratios of 1.01 (95% confidence interval [95% CI]: 1.002 to 1.01) for extent of CAL ≥3 mm, 1.10 (95% CI: 1.03 to 1.18) for mean CAL, and 1.03 (95% CI: 1.01 to 1.04) for the number of missing teeth regarding all-cause mortality. Analogous results were obtained for CVD mortality, with hazard ratios of 1.01 (95% CI: 0.99 to 1.02), 1.10 (95% CI: 0.98 to 1.23), and 1.02 (95% CI: 0.99 to 1.05) for extent of CAL, mean CAL, and the number of missing teeth, respectively. Findings did not indicate additive interaction of periodontal destruction and diabetes regarding all-cause and CVD mortality. Similarly, no substantial evidence was found to demonstrate the presence of multiplicative interaction or mediation. Besides adjustment for baseline covariates, time-varying covariates were also considered and led to comparable results. In summary, despite their reciprocal relationship, periodontal destruction and diabetes may be independent risk factors for all-cause and CVD mortality. [ABSTRACT FROM AUTHOR]

Objectives: To compare the therapeutic effectiveness of corticosteroids (CS) alone vs. CS plus d-penicillamine (d-Pen) in severe eosinophilic fasciitis., Method: A long-term prospective non-randomized trial of d-Pen plus CS vs. CS alone in patients with severe eosinophilic fasciitis, defined as clinically apparent cutaneous fibrotic involvement affecting more than 15% body surface area (BSA) or more than 10% BSA with joint flexion contractures., Results: Sixteen patients with severe eosinophilic fasciitis entered the study. Ten patients received d-Pen plus CS and six received CS alone. Affected BSA decreased from an average of 29% to 8.9% in the d-Pen plus CS group compared to a decrease in affected BSA from 28% to 22.83% in the CS-alone group. The reduction in affected BSA in the d-Pen plus CS group was significantly greater than in the CS-alone group (p = 0.038). Clinical improvement occurred in all d-Pen plus CS patients compared to only 33.3% of CS-alone patients (p = 0.008). There was no difference in overall frequency of adverse events between the groups (p = 0.60). The most common adverse event in the d-Pen plus CS group was proteinuria (33.3%). However, proteinuria also occurred in 16.6% in the CS-alone group., Conclusions: Treatment with CS alone failed to induce clinical improvement in the majority of the severe eosinophilic fasciitis patients. By contrast, d-Pen plus CS resulted in significantly greater clinical improvement. These results suggest that initial treatment of severe eosinophilic fasciitis with CS alone is not sufficient for optimal therapeutic response and that addition of an antifibrotic agent results in an improved outcome.
